QSAR of 1, 4-Benzoxazin-2, 3- and 3, 1-Benzoxazin-2, 4-dione Antimicrobial Analogues
Recently, different benzoxazindione analogues were investigated for their antiviral, antiallergic and tocolytic oxytocin receptor activities. The benzoxazinone analogue efavirenz, i.e. 6-chloro-4-(cycloprophylethynyl)-1, 4-dihydro-4-(trifluoromethyl)-2H-3, 1-benzoxazin-2-one, was approved as antiretroviral drug, a non-nucleoside type of reverse transcriptase inhibitor. In extension of our previous QSAR studies using topological indices, TIs (W, X1, J), the QSAR of 1, 4-benzoxazin-2, 3-dione and 3, 1-benzoxazin-2, 4-dione analogues were explored using different computed molecular descriptors (MDs) and experimentally obtained parameters for antimicrobial activity (MIC). The biological activity were evaluated using G(+) and G(-) test bacteria and Candida monosa. In this study additional TIs and other MDs were explored (CID, X1, X MOD, VRA1, BID, Sv, Se and ALOGP) using multiple linear regression analysis. Previous results have shown significant correlation between antimicrobial activity (MIC) and topological indices (TIs), while in present, which are in good agreement with previously obtained, correlations indicate the preference of biological predictability on the basis of two or more TIs. This approach allows an investigation of influences more than one descriptor on particular system such as combination of constitutional (Sv, Se, ..), topological (ISIZ, MV1, … ), and molecular properties (ALOGP, MLOGP) descriptors.
